The Gold Tips’ “Hold On” finds the soul in movement, love and conviction

 


Gold Tips are back with a new single and official music video, “Hold On.” It’s a soulful, emotional, moving experience that speaks of human connection on a deeper level. It’s a release that tackles the intersection of love, morality, and conviction, providing the track with a thoughtful emotional foundation while allowing the energy to shine through.

What makes “Hold On” particularly appealing is the way The Gold Tips tie its musical identity to the visual language of the accompanying video. The video not only offers the song as something to listen to, but it also revels in the physical and emotional force of soul music, with dance and free movement at the heart of the experience.

The visual presentation has a natural feel-good quality. Movement is more than choreography, it is a way of expressing energy, freedom and connection. That method lends a warm immediacy to “Hold On,” giving the release a sense of life rather than being over-produced.

The film also displays one of the distinguishing attributes of soul music, its capacity to move people in every meaning of the word. The music creates an emotional, physical, and social space where one can relate to the emotions rather than see them.
